The stories we tell ourselves matter. When my son took his life, I had an immediate story I was telling myself full of self-pity and judgment--and in this poem, I write about the moment that frame changed and the enormous difference that has made in my life.
"The Invitation" is a track on DARK PRAISE, a spoken-word album that honors the dark and how it opens us to creativity, passion, intimacy, revelation, dreaming, receptivity, self-discovery and connection. THE INVITATION
Two nights after he died,
all night I heard the same
one-line story on repeat:
I am the woman whose son
took his life. The words
felt full of self-pity,
filled me with hopelessness, doom.
And then a voice came,
a woman’s voice, just before dawn,
and it gave me a new shade of truth:
I am the woman who learns
how to love him now that he’s gone.
It did not change the facts,
but it changed everything
about how I met the facts.
Over a hundred days later,
I am still learning what it means
to love him-how love is
an ocean, a wildfire, a crumb;
how commitment to love changes me,
changes everyone,
invites us to bring our best.
Love is wine, is trampoline,
is an infinite song with a chorus
in which I am sung.
I am the woman who learns
how to love him now that he’s gone.
May I always be learning how to love-
like a cave. Like a rough-legged hawk.
Like a sun.
--Rosemerry Wahtola Trommer, published in All the Honey (Samara Press, 2023)
